摘要This paper consists of a review of investigations and the factors affecting the fatigue of Mg and its alloys. The effect of materials, loading conditions and environmental factors on fatigue is discussed in detail. Particular attention has been paid to the influence of frequencies and the pH value of solutions on the fatigue life. The correlation between the threshold stress intensity factor range (Delta K(th)) and load ratio (R) for Mg alloy fatigue crack propagation (FCP) is summarized in a figure. Finally, the mechanisms of fatigue and corrosion fatigue (CF), crack initiation and crack propagation are also discussed.
